Spoilers for 'Yellowstone' Season 3 Episode 5 'Cowboys and Dreamers'

'Yellowstone' did a cold open tonight by answering one of the most pressing questions fans have had since the show started - why does Beth Dutton (Kelly Reilly) hate her elder brother Jamie Dutton (Wes Bentley).

To say that the two have had a love-hate relationship doesn't cut it, they have gone beyond their limits to belittle and berate the other and until now viewers of the show had no idea why two siblings could possibly hate each other so much. In Season 3 Episode 5, it is revealed with a flashback scene. Kylie Rogers, Dalton Baker and Kyle Red Silverstein reprise the adolescent versions of Beth, Jamie and Rip respectively. And what Taylor Sheridan reveals this episode is heartbreaking. 

When Beth finds out she is pregnant, she seeks help from Jamie, who takes her to the free clinic on the reservation. There, he is warned that Beth will be sterilized and won't just abort the baby. He still goes ahead with it without telling her the truth. 

And so it begins.
